Main information about car part INTERBRAKE 535027030
Producer INTERBRAKE
Number 535027030
Description Freewheel Clutch, alternator
Analogue of INTERBRAKE 535027030
AUTEX AUTEX 655101 655101 Freewheel Clutch, alternator
IPD IPD 15-4096 154096 Freewheel Clutch, alternator